
One of the easiest ways to change up a fall winter look is with a scarf and hat. Most of us gravitate to safe neutrals.
I would probably pair black with this coat. But change up the colour and all of a sudden you have a whole new look.

Is it just me or has finding fall winter accessories been a bit harder this year? Usually I have found all sorts of scarves and hats I want to add to my closet. They are such an inexpensive way to add versatility. It is much more affordable to have a closet full of scarves than a closet full of coats. My usual haunts for scarves and hats either are just getting stock now or don’t have anything I want. I have found so many retailers are sticking with just neutrals this year as they are safe but it makes from some seriously snoozeworthy shopping.
